Mall sale promos, payday cause heavy traffic on EDSA


Motorists and commuters passing through parts of Metro Manila may have to be more patient this weekend, due in part to heavy traffic caused by some malls' weekend sale promos.
 
On Friday, traffic slowed down near two malls in Mandaluyong City, due to weekend sale promos in the area, GMA News' Susan Enriquez reported on "24 Oras."
 

The report said traffic was very slow at the part of Epifanio delos Santos Avenue (EDSA) in Mandaluyong City.
 
Despite this, many shoppers continued to brave the traffic, as they were attracted to the prospect of buying items at big discounts.
 
Many of them said they wanted to buy items as Christmas gifts, noting the sale could offer as much as 70 percent discount.
 
For its part, the Metropolitan Manila Development Authority deployed additional personnel to try to ease the traffic flow.
 
On the other hand, vendors took advantage of traffic jams to hawk their wares including bottled water and food. —Joel Locsin/NB, GMA News
